MLS suspends Schelotto for elbow on Umana

Soccer By Ives 18 May @ 06:50 PM EDT Blog Details : Related Items
3 views

Major League Soccer has suspended Columbus Crew star Guillermo Barros Schelotto for one match for throwing an elbow and hitting Chivas USA defender Michael Umana during the Crew's 1-0 win last Saturday.

Schelotto will miss the Crew's match against the New York Red Bulls at Red Bull Arena on Thursday night after the league ruled on Tuesday on the incident, which was missed by the match referee.

U.S. Unveils Preliminary World Cup Roster

Major League Soccer Talk 11 May @ 03:10 PM EDT Blog Details : Related Items
2 views

Today's the day.

U.S. National Team coach Bob Bradley pulled the curtain back on his 30-man preliminary World Cup roster today, and while he still has to whittle that down to a 23-man group in the next couple of weeks, here are those invited to the camp at Princeton.

Goalkeepers: Tim Howard, Brad Guzan and Marcus Hahnemann

Defenders: Carlos Bocanegra, Oguchi Onyewu, Steve Cherundolo, Jonathan Spector, Jay DeMerit, Clarence Goodson, Jonathan Bornstein, Heath Pearce and Chad Marshall

Midfielders: Landon Donovan, Clint Dempsey, Michael Bradley, Stuart Holden, Ricardo Clark, Maurice Edu, Benny Feilhaber, Jose Francisco Torres, Alejandro Bedoya, DaMarcus Beasley, Sacha Kljestian and Robbie Rogers

Forwards: Jozy Altidore, Robbie Findley, Brian Ching, Edson Buddle, Eddie Johnson and Herculez Gomez

Missing from the roster are, among others, Charlie Davies, Conor Casey and Freddy Adu.

USA announces 30-man provisional World Cup roster

Soccer By Ives 11 May @ 02:23 PM EDT Blog Details : Related Items
1 views

Charlie Davies' quest to make the U.S. World Cup team appears over, but the dream is alive for 30 others.

Davies was not named to the U.S. team's 30-man provisional World Cup roster. Herculez Gomez and Edson Buddle did make the list, as did Eddie Johnson.

U.S. national team head coach Bob Bradley stated that Davies was in consideration right up until Monday, and that club team Sochaux had yet to fully clear him, which played a part in the decision to leave Davies off the squad.
